
1. Noah says that 9x - 2x + 4x is equivalent to 3x, because the subtraction sign tells us to subtract everything that comes after 9x.
Elena says taht 9x - 2x + 4x is equivalent to 11x because the subtraction only applies to 2x.
Do you agree with either of them?

5. Solve the inequality that represents each story. Then interpret what the solution means in the story.
a) For every $9 that Elena earns, she gives x dollars to charity. This happens 7 times this month. Elena wants to be sure she keeps at least $42 from this month's earnings.
7(9 - x) ≥ 42
